Fairgrounds Fantasy [orch]

The Fairgrounds Fantasy is a ten minute work for orchestra which is roughly divided into an opening theme and variations and a closing moto perpetuo. The piece includes evocations of spinning and disorientation, much like an overwhelming walk through a fairground at night. The piece received a reading in winter 2001 and would need significant revision were it to be performed again. Unfortunately, the recording from the reading session is unusable.
